1st Question
This is a traditional Indian game that is played in the state of Assam. This game consists of 2 eleven member teams on a 125m * 80m field bounded by four flags. The players take turns throwing the ball at the opponent to knock them out of the game, while seeking to catch the ball and evade other players. It is a test of speed, stamina, and acrobatic skills. This game was actually played to amuse ahom royalty as a spectator sport. Identify the game.

In 2001, The Sun, a British tabloid newspaper reported that queen Elizabeth 2 has this in her bathroom that wears an inflatable crown. It was spotted by a workman who was repainting her bathroom. The story prompted sales of it in the UK to increase by 80% for a short period. What is it?
